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/effekseer/effekseerformultilanguages
https://github.com/effekseer/effekseerformultilanguages
Last synced: 9 days ago
JSON representation
- Host: GitHub
- URL: https://github.com/effekseer/effekseerformultilanguages
- Owner: effekseer
- Created: 2020-04-05T12:18:28.000Z (over 4 years ago)
- Default Branch: master
- Last Pushed: 2023-07-10T11:54:38.000Z (over 1 year ago)
- Last Synced: 2024-05-01T11:42:53.463Z (7 months ago)
- Language: C++
- Size: 263 KB
- Stars: 8
- Watchers: 9
- Forks: 12
- Open Issues: 9
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
## EffekseerForMultiLanguages
Effekseer for C#, Java and Python
### Requirements
- git
- python
- C++ compiler
- cmake (3.15 or later)
- swig
- JDK (If you develop it for JVM)
- ant (If you develop it for JVM)### Build
```
git clone https://github.com/effekseer/EffekseerForMultiLanguages.git
cd EffekseerForMultiLanguages
git submodule update --init
```#### Windows
```
cd src
generate_swig_wrapper.bat
cd ..
```#### Mac, Linux
```
cd src
sh generate_swig_wrapper.sh
cd ..
``````
cmake -B build -S .
```## How to use
### libGDX
please see examples
#### Windows
call ```python examples/build_libGtxSample.py ```
## How to Develop
### TODO
https://github.com/effekseer/EffekseerForMultiLanguages/issues
### Requeiments
- swig
### Reference
https://github.com/effekseer/EffekseerForWebGL/blob/master/src/cpp/main.cpp